"Indigeneity describes principles of how to be in a specific place, and the kinds of laws or rules or protocols that human beings could practice within those principles. Indigeneity can still apply in a contemporary context, without humans having to go back to the woods of a thousand years ago. (Mind you, that would be nice too.)"
